Skip to content

Instantly share code, notes, and snippets.

View s1rat-dev's full-sized avatar
🏹

Sırat Semih Çöp s1rat-dev

🏹
View GitHub Profile
@s1rat-dev
s1rat-dev / functions.ts
Created February 19, 2022 14:08
[TYPESCRIPT] Annotations for functions.
const addNumbers = (a: number, b: number): number => {
return a + b;
};
// Inference
const subtractNums = (a: number, b: number) => {
return a - b;
};
// function subtractNums( a: number, b: number): number
@s1rat-dev
s1rat-dev / variables.ts
Created February 19, 2022 00:16
[TYPESCRIPT] Annotations for variables.
let apples: number = 5;
let speed: string = 'fast';
let hasName: boolean = true;
let nothingMuch: null = null;
let nothing: undefined = undefined;
Library IEEE;
USE ieee.std_logic_1164.all;
Entity Mux4to1 IS
PORT(A,B,C,D: IN std_logic_vector(1 downto 0);
I: IN std_logic_vector(1 downto 0);
O: OUT std_logic_vector(1 downto 0));
END Mux4to1;
CREATE TABLE public.activation_codes
(
id integer NOT NULL,
userid integer,
verificationcode character varying(8) COLLATE pg_catalog."default",
activationdate timestamp with time zone,
CONSTRAINT activation_codes_pkey PRIMARY KEY (id)
)
TABLESPACE pg_default;
@s1rat-dev
s1rat-dev / Matplotlip Grafik Türleri.ipynb
Last active March 2, 2021 11:45
[PYTHON] Matplotlib modülünde başlıca yer alan grafikler ve bu grafiklerin kullanımı.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@s1rat-dev
s1rat-dev / Matplotlib.ipynb
Last active March 1, 2021 19:02
[PYTHON] Matplotlib modülü ile verileri grafik haline getirme ve Matplotlib'in kısaca kullanımı.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@s1rat-dev
s1rat-dev / dataframe youtube.py
Created February 27, 2021 14:07
[PYTHON] Pandas konusunun anlaşılabilirliği adına 15 soruluk örnek ve çözümleri.
import pandas as pd
data = pd.read_csv('GBvideos.csv')
df = pd.DataFrame(data)
##################################################################################
# 1- İlk on kaydı getirin.
result = df.head(10)
@s1rat-dev
s1rat-dev / pandas dataframe nba_Players.csv
Created February 27, 2021 14:01
[PYTHON] Pandas konularının anlaşılabilirliği için 11 soruluk örnek ve çözümleri.
Player height weight collage born birth_city birth_state
0 Curly Armstrong 180 77 Indiana University 1918
1 Cliff Barker 188 83 University of Kentucky 1921 Yorktown Indiana
2 Leo Barnhorst 193 86 University of Notre Dame 1924
3 Ed Bartels 196 88 North Carolina State University 1925
4 Ralph Beard 178 79 University of Kentucky 1927 Hardinsburg Kentucky
5 Gene Berce 180 79 Marquette University 1926
6 Charlie Black 196 90 University of Kansas 1921 Arco Idaho
7 Nelson Bobb 183 77 Temple University 1924 Philadelphia Pennsylvania
8 Jake Bornheimer 196 90 Muhlenberg College 1927 New Brunswick New Jersey
@s1rat-dev
s1rat-dev / pandas dataframe methods.py
Created February 26, 2021 07:51
[PYTHON] Pandas DataFrame methodlarının (unique,nunique,sort,pivot_table vs.) incelenmesi.
import pandas as pd
import numpy as np
data = {
'Column1': [1,2,3,4,5,6],
'Column2': [10,20,13,20,25,-3],
'Column3': ['abc','bca','ade','cba','dea','cbea']
}
@s1rat-dev
s1rat-dev / pandas merge join.py
Created February 25, 2021 10:34
[PYTHON] Pandas ile veri birleştirme, inner, left, right ve outer join formülleri ve 'concat' kavramı.
import pandas as pd
customers = {
'customerID': [1,2,3,4],
'firstName': ['Ahmet','Ali','Hasan','Canan'],
'lastName' : ['Yılmaz','Korkmaz','Çelik','Toprak'],
}